Build 3037 is part of that legacy. According to available records, was released around August 1, 2018 . This places it as a mature, stable point release after the initial launch of Portraiture 3, incorporating user feedback and minor optimizations. It was available for both Windows and macOS and was designed primarily as a plugin for Adobe Photoshop, with additional support for Adobe Photoshop Lightroom. imagenomic portraiture 303 build 3037
